May 12, 2025State of bait: Minnows plentiful for opener, but concern remains for industry long-termFishing is a $4 billion industry in the state of Minnesota. With a good crop of minnows this spring after last year's shortage, Northern Minnesotans in the bait industry share their views and concerns with KAXE's Larissa Donovan....more6minPlay

May 05, 2025The unhoused in the Brainerd area have nowhere legal to sleep this summerPeople like William, George and Jeffery don't know where they'll live over the summer in the wake of a camping ban and the City Council's rejection of a plan to keep the shelter open year-round....more6minPlay
